Abstract

A milling device having a first milling station with a first workpiece spindle capable of rotating about a first spindle axis Aintended to receive a first lens blank and with a first milling tool with first cutters capable of rotating about a first milling axis FAintended for machining a received first lens blank. At least one second milling station with a second workpiece spindle capable of rotating about a second spindle axis Areceives a second lens blank, and with a second milling tool with second cutters capable of rotating about a second milling axis FAmachining the received second lens blank, the spindle axes A, Abeing aligned parallel to one another, the milling axes FA, FAbeing aligned parallel to one another, and obliquely aligned to the spindle axes A, A. The invention also includes a method for the operation of the milling device.
